WebDeadheading refers to a gardening practice where any spent flowers are removed from a plant. This can be done for aesthetic purposes or for the benefit of the plant. When deadheading, the flowers are cut or pinched from the point where they join the stem. In doing this, further growth is encouraged. WebCanna lilies need deadheading regularly throughout the spring and summer growing season. They can grow up to 3 flower stems from each leaf stem if they are cut regularly. Wait until the flower have dropped off and the seed pods have begun to form. Snip the flower head just above the last seed pod.
